1

错误文本:

本地报告处理过程中发生错误。报告“主报告”的定义无效。报告定义无效。

详细信息:报表定义具有无法升级的无效目标命名空间
http://schemas.microsoft.com/sqlserver/reporting/2008/01/reportdefinition ”。

我不能在我的笔记本电脑上运行任何报告。但它在我的办公系统中运行良好。任何帮助表示赞赏。

编辑:排除和重新包括不工作。

我的“C:\Program Files(x86)\MSBuild\Microsoft\VisualStudio\v10.0\ReportingServices\Microsoft.ReportingServices.targets”文件没有改变。它的版本是 10.0.0

4

1 回答 1

2

编辑:如果您想知道它为什么首先起作用,请转到参考并右键单击 microsoft.Reportviewer.Common 并单击对象浏览器中的视图。在这里您可以看到它指向不兼容的 9.0 版(至少在第 10 节中)。

更改参考有效(从版本 9.0 到 10.0)。右键单击引用并从 C:\Program Files\Microsoft Visual Studio 10.0\ReportViewer 添加引用,然后添加那里给出的所有 dll(在从项目引用中删除与报告相关的 dll 之后)。

给出的所有评论都向我展示了正确的路径。为像我这样的初学者发布这个相当简单的答案。

于 2015-02-02T05:37:13.407 回答